In answer to the actual question: I play pretty much exclusively 1/2-step down from standard. It helps with singing, it makes the guitar sound bigger (esp. with light-top/heavy bottoms) and it fits with my roots: SRV and old Van Halen, both of them played down 1/2 step from A440.
When I need to detune for fun low tones I already start off 1/2 step below standard and DR JH-.010's can handle the low tones just fine, with the tite-fit .056 that masses more.

Sleepflower posted:

IIRC it's a pain in the rear end to apply.

It's unstable as gently caress so it's iffy to store (I'm not 100% but I think my insurance is voided by having a can of it in there, also it can't be legally transported by air and it has special restrictions on being transported by road), it takes ages to cure and it lets moisture in (which is why they stopped using it for cars). It's the 21st century and there is literally no reason to use nitro unless you are repairing a vintage instrument or something. I guess it gets a nice paitina when the finish ages but you can do that with polyurethane pretty easily.
